Imaging Director

Samaritan, Moses Lake, WA, United States


Imaging Director

Full‑time salary exempt position.

You are responsible for the daily operations of the department, including staff, productivity, budget, equipment, customer service, and patient relations. You also develop and implement a policy and procedure system to facilitate departmental operations. The Imaging Director reviews work schedules, participates in hiring, and implements strategies to recruit and retain employees. This position directly oversees the Imaging Services and staff operating imaging equipment ranging from an X‑ray machine to MRI equipment. This role requires excellent leadership skills with a philosophy of creating a high‑trust culture that empowers employees as individual contributors and fosters a strong team environment. Initiative, creativity, and outstanding written and verbal communications are required. Demonstrated ability to find creative solutions to complex problems. The individual reports to the Chief Administrative Officer.

Position Qualifications

  • Bachelor’s degree in a related field required; Master’s degree preferred.
  • Graduate of AMA and JCERT two (2) year Radiologic Technology program.
  • Seven (7) years post‑graduate experience with minimum three (3) years in an acute care/hospital setting.
  • Five (5) years supervisory/management experience preferred.
  • ARRT Registered; Washington State Radiologic technology license within six (6) months of hire; expertise or credentialed in one other modality.
  • Knowledge of Washington State Nuclear medicine regulations and knowledge of PACS preferred.
  • Basic Life Support (BLS) Heartsaver level to be completed within three (3) months of hire.
